Common Solar Panel Installation & Repair Scams in Bovina
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Fake Rebate Promises
Scammers claim huge non-existent rebates or incentives, charging 'processing fees' upfront.
Deposit and Disappear
Take a big deposit for panels or install, do shoddy work or vanish entirely.
Bait-and-Switch Panels
Quote premium panels cheap, then deliver low-quality or add surprise fees.
Unlicensed 'Contractors'
Pose as experts without proper TX licensing, leading to code violations and void warranties.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a certificate of insurance for general liability ($1M+) and workers' comp. Call the insurer to confirm it's current and covers your job.
Licensing
Texas solar installers need an active electrical contractor license from TDLR. Search by name or number on https://www.tdlr.texas.gov/electricians/eleclook.htm. Check for complaints and expiration date.
References
Ask for 3+ recent Parmer County or nearby references. Call them to verify work quality, timelines, and satisfaction.
